Output 588034dea43fdd7a4eec0b74b0ca69b9120dd26e52f31a290ccf8b083ac3c3c7:8

value
2447250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ebb91bf6392b323c97c88c8764f285bb263d29a OP_EQUAL
address
35x7huvQ9g9YajDvPFS3KUcoJhv8oY5oZX
transaction
588034dea43fdd7a4eec0b74b0ca69b9120dd26e52f31a290ccf8b083ac3c3c7
spent
true